William Clark, born on August 1, 1770, and died on September 1, 1838, was a renowned American explorer. He is best known for leading the Lewis and Clark Expedition from 1804 to 1806, which was the first scientific exploration of the American West, profoundly impacting the geography, culture, and politics of the United States.

Jule Styne, born on December 31, 1905, was a renowned American composer and lyricist. His works spanned various genres including musicals, films, and popular music, with his most famous compositions including 'Diamonds Are a Girl's Best Friend' from 'Gentlemen Prefer Blondes' and 'People' from 'Funny Girl'. Styne's musical talent and creative abilities made him one of the most successful musicians of the 20th century.

Jean-Jacques Dessalines was a pivotal figure in the Haitian Revolution, serving as a revolutionary leader and the first ruler of Haiti following its independence from French colonial rule. Born on September 20, 1758, and dying on October 17, 1806, Dessalines was instrumental in the struggle for Haitian sovereignty, leading the Haitian forces to victory in the Battle of Vertières and playing a significant role in the drafting of the Haitian Declaration of Independence in 1804.
